Description

this is a mechanical chase light marquee sign, see this video for more information:

Originally made as an Add-On for the 2025 Hackaday Berlin badge (I am not associated with Hackaday, the Skull and Wrenches Logo are Trademarks of Hackaday.com). 

The print files come blank without any logo.

parts needed:

  • N20 motor
  • bright LEDs in any form
  • 2 short M3 screws, e.g. 6mm (they are friction fit, no thradmaking needed)

Print tips:

  • the base plate needs to be printed with the first layer being transparent, then the next layers need to be black or at least opaque. 
  • The two masks are identical, though it makes sense to flip one copy upside down to have a cleaner surface.
  • Some parts need to be flipped to a flat surface before printing.
  • In my version “light_spreader_transparent” was made using lasercut acrylic, though a transparent print should also work fine to provide a glowing background.

Assembly:

Please see the following exploded diagram of the stack . I also provide a STEP file you can open in most CAD programs to explore the design.
